PESHAWAR: Dr Gulzar. A.Jalal, head of English Department, Edwardes College Peshawar, has been appointed as member Board of Governors of the Pakistan Academy of Letters (PAL), Islamabad, for a period of three years.
A press release said he will represent the government of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a in the board The National Heritage and Culture Division issued a notification in this regard on the 7th Nov, 2023.
Dr Gulzar Jalal was nominated by caretaker chief minister through a notification of Khyber Pakhtunkwa Government, Administration Department on October 9. He has always sought the promotion of language, literature and culture and the appointment has recognized his contribution.
